Abstract

Covering the whole set of Pareto-optimal solutions is a desired task of multiobjective optimization methods. Because in general it is not possible to determine this set, a restricted amount of solutions are typically delivered in the output to decision makers. We propose a method using multiobjective particle swarm optimization to cover the Pareto-optimal front. The method works in two phases. In phase 1 the goal is to obtain a good approximation of the Pareto-front. In a second run subswarms are generated to cover the Pareto-front. The method is evaluated using different test functions and compared with an existing covering method using a real world example in antenna design.
